Strategic Summary
Overview
Reply.io and Seamless.ai both promise to automate outbound demand generation, but they solve fundamentally different problems for different organizational maturity levels. Reply.io positions itself as a full-stack sales engagement platform with AI-powered personalization layered onto multi-channel workflows (email, LinkedIn, calls, SMS). Seamless.ai, by contrast, is primarily a real-time B2B database and intent-detection engine that feeds into your existing sales stack—it's less about orchestration and more about feeding your team better leads with higher confidence signals.
The strategic difference matters enormously. Reply.io assumes you need help with campaign management, sequence design, and execution across channels. It's built for teams that want a single platform to manage their entire outbound motion—from list building to follow-up cadences to analytics. The platform includes native AI for subject line generation, email body personalization, and even conversation intelligence. This appeals to mid-market companies (50-500 sales reps) that have outbound as a core motion but lack the operational sophistication to coordinate multiple point solutions.
Seamless.ai takes a different bet: your team already has tools (Outreach, Salesloft, HubSpot, or even Reply.io itself), but you're drowning in bad data and guessing on intent. Seamless provides real-time verification of B2B contact information, intent signals (job changes, company funding, technographics), and AI-powered lead scoring. It's a data and intelligence layer, not a campaign engine. This appeals to larger, more sophisticated sales organizations (500+ reps) that have already invested in sales engagement platforms and need to improve conversion rates by feeding them better, more intent-rich leads.
Our Recommendation: Reply
Reply.io wins for most CMOs and VP Sales leaders because it solves the complete demand generation problem—data, personalization, execution, and measurement—in one platform. Seamless.ai is superior only if your organization already has mature sales engagement infrastructure and your bottleneck is specifically lead quality and intent data, not campaign orchestration.
Choose Reply when...
Choose Reply.io if you're a mid-market company (50-300 sales reps) building or scaling outbound as a primary demand channel, or if your team currently uses 4+ point solutions and you want to consolidate. Reply.io's all-in-one approach reduces operational friction and gives you faster time-to-value. It's also the better choice if your sales team lacks sales engagement discipline—Reply's workflows and templates enforce best practices.
Choose Seamless when...
Choose Seamless.ai if you're an enterprise with 500+ reps, already use Outreach/Salesloft/HubSpot, and your conversion rates are suffering because your reps are calling cold leads without intent signals. Seamless is also better if your primary constraint is data quality and real-time verification—your team doesn't need another campaign tool, they need smarter lead routing and confidence scoring to prioritize their outbound efforts.
